diff --git a/applications/utilities/thermophysical/adiabaticFlameT/adiabaticFlameT.C b/applications/utilities/thermophysical/adiabaticFlameT/adiabaticFlameT.C index e00da5e9e5..58de0b6f77 100644 --- a/applications/utilities/thermophysical/adiabaticFlameT/adiabaticFlameT.C +++ b/applications/utilities/thermophysical/adiabaticFlameT/adiabaticFlameT.C @@ -69,6 +69,7 @@ int main(int argc, char *argv[]) dictionary control(controlFile); + scalar P(readScalar(control.lookup("P"))); scalar T0(readScalar(control.lookup("T0"))); const word fuelName(control.lookup("fuel")); scalar n(readScalar(control.lookup("n"))); @@ -179,7 +180,7 @@ int main(int argc, char *argv[]) Info<< "products " << (1/products.nMoles())*products << ';' << endl; - scalar Tad = products.THa(reactants.Ha(T0), 1000.0); + scalar Tad = products.THa(reactants.Ha(P, T0), P, 1000.0); Info<< "Tad = " << Tad << nl << endl; } diff --git a/applications/utilities/thermophysical/equilibriumCO/equilibriumCO.C b/applications/utilities/thermophysical/equilibriumCO/equilibriumCO.C index 00391cbd68..dde7e8678a 100644 --- a/applications/utilities/thermophysical/equilibriumCO/equilibriumCO.C +++ b/applications/utilities/thermophysical/equilibriumCO/equilibriumCO.C @@ -50,9 +50,8 @@ typedef specieThermo, absoluteEnthalpy> thermo; int main(int argc, char *argv[]) { - -# include "setRootCase.H" -# include "createTime.H" + #include "setRootCase.H" + #include "createTime.H" Info<< nl << "Reading Burcat data IOdictionary" << endl; @@ -71,6 +70,7 @@ int main(int argc, char *argv[]) + scalar P = 1e5; scalar T = 3000.0; SLPtrList EQreactions; @@ -121,7 +121,7 @@ int main(int argc, char *argv[]) forAllConstIter(SLPtrList, EQreactions, iter) { - Info<< "Kc(EQreactions) = " << iter().Kc(T) << endl; + Info<< "Kc(EQreactions) = " << iter().Kc(P, T) << endl; } Info<< nl << "end" << endl; @@ -131,4 +131,3 @@ int main(int argc, char *argv[]) // ************************************************************************* // - diff --git a/applications/utilities/thermophysical/equilibriumFlameT/equilibriumFlameT.C b/applications/utilities/thermophysical/equilibriumFlameT/equilibriumFlameT.C index cfb5d71d74..8cf2371898 100644 --- a/applications/utilities/thermophysical/equilibriumFlameT/equilibriumFlameT.C +++ b/applications/utilities/thermophysical/equilibriumFlameT/equilibriumFlameT.C @@ -242,7 +242,7 @@ int main(int argc, char *argv[]) scalar equilibriumFlameTemperatureNew = - products.THa(reactants.Ha(T0), adiabaticFlameTemperature); + products.THa(reactants.Ha(P, T0), P, adiabaticFlameTemperature); if (j==0) { diff --git a/applications/utilities/thermophysical/mixtureAdiabaticFlameT/mixtureAdiabaticFlameT.C b/applications/utilities/thermophysical/mixtureAdiabaticFlameT/mixtureAdiabaticFlameT.C index 02d4787f28..728897c88a 100644 --- a/applications/utilities/thermophysical/mixtureAdiabaticFlameT/mixtureAdiabaticFlameT.C +++ b/applications/utilities/thermophysical/mixtureAdiabaticFlameT/mixtureAdiabaticFlameT.C @@ -69,6 +69,7 @@ int main(int argc, char *argv[]) dictionary control(controlFile); + scalar P(readScalar(control.lookup("P"))); scalar T0(readScalar(control.lookup("T0"))); mixture rMix(control.lookup("reactants")); mixture pMix(control.lookup("products")); @@ -116,7 +117,7 @@ int main(int argc, char *argv[]) } Info<< "Adiabatic flame temperature of mixture " << rMix.name() << " = " - << products.THa(reactants.Ha(T0), 1000.0) << " K" << endl; + << products.THa(reactants.Ha(P, T0), P, 1000.0) << " K" << endl; return 0; }